Peoria police chase yields arrest of 8 teens, recovery of 3 stolen cars and 2 guns

PEORIA — Multiple calls about reckless drivers early Wednesday evening had Peoria police searching for several suspects throughout the city, according to a police report.

Peoria police began searching for suspects after multiple calls rolled in around 5:52 p.m. Wednesday, June 28, the release said.

An unreported stolen vehicle was located by police at Jefferson Avenue and Spring Street, just before two previously reported stolen vehicles raced past police. Police pursued the two vehicles as the two cars followed each other at high rates of speed, with occupants seen hanging out of car windows as the chase ensued along Sheridan Road and War Memorial Drive.

Multiple attempts to stop the vehicles fell short until the first stolen vehicle slammed into another car near War Memorial Drive and Knoxville Avenue. That's when the suspects jumped out of the first vehicle and piled into the second stolen car before fleeing.

Victims of the crash suffered minor injuries.

Shortly after, police observed the second stolen vehicle fail to make a turn from Flora Avenue onto Archer Avenue, where all occupants fled the scene on foot once the car came to a complete stop.

Officers from all divisions of the Peoria Police Department were able to track down eight fleeing juvenile suspects from the scene.

In the end, officers recovered three stolen vehicles and two guns.

Here's a look what the eight juveniles were arrested for during the investigation:

  1. 14-year-old female: possession of a stolen motor vehicle and resisting/obstructing; transported to the Peoria County Juvenile Detention Center.

  2. 15-year-old female: possession of a stolen motor vehicle, obstructing identification, resisting/obstructing and listed on 4 individual retail theft cases; transported to Peoria County Juvenile Detention Center.

  3. 15-year-old male: possession of a stolen motor vehicle and resisting/obstructing; transported to Peoria County Juvenile Detention Center.

  4. 16-year-old female: possession of a stolen motor vehicle and resisting/obstructing; released to mother's custody.

  5. 16-year-old male: possession of a stolen motor vehicle and resisting/obstructing and unlawful use of a weapon (UUW); transported to Peoria County Juvenile Detention Center.

  6. 16-year-old male: was arrested for possession of a stolen motor vehicle and resisting/obstructing; transported to Peoria County Juvenile Detention Center.

  7. 17-year-old female: possession of a stolen motor vehicle and resisting/obstructing; and a Peoria County Warrant.

  8. 17-year-old male: criminal trespass to a motor vehicle, possession of a stolen firearm and aggravated UUW; transported to Peoria County Juvenile Detention Center.

According to police, several of the above individuals have a significant previous arrest history.
